Abstract

A method is provided that includes storing a plurality of data items in a data aggregation system. Each of the plurality of data items is associated with one or more location identifiers indicating a particular point on the earth. The method further includes receiving, by at least one processor, a query indicating a geographic location. Data items having associated location identifiers matching the received geographic location are retrieved from the data aggregation system. The method further includes outputting the retrieved data items.

Claims (44)

1. A method, comprising:

storing a plurality of data items in a data aggregation system, each of the plurality of data items being associated with one or more geographic location identifiers of a particular geographic point on earth, wherein at least a portion of the plurality of data items stored in the data aggregation system are further associated with one or more time identifiers including one or more time or time periods, indicative of a time history of an associated data item regarding the associated geographic point on earth;

receiving, by at least one processor, a query regarding a geographic location and including time information;

retrieving, from the data aggregation system, data items having associated geographic location identifiers matching the received geographic location and having associated time identifiers matching the received time information; and

outputting the retrieved data items.

2. The method of claim 1 , wherein the one or more geographic location identifiers include latitude and longitude coordinates of a surface of the earth.

3. The method of claim 2 , wherein the one or more geographic location identifiers further include at least one of a height above or a depth below the surface of the earth.

4. The method of claim 1 , wherein the received geographic location includes a region on the earth.

5. The method of claim 4 , wherein the region on the earth is identified by multiple geocoded locations, the multiple geocoded locations described in at least latitude and longitude coordinates.

6. The method of claim 1 , wherein the time information of the query includes one or more time periods.

7. The method of claim 1 , wherein the one or more location identifiers include content external to the data aggregation system.

8. The method of claim 1 , wherein the stored data items include at least one of: tax data, building code data, weather data, insurance data, crime data, survey data, school data, demographic data and property data.
